Mold closing nail and luggage trundle using same
By combining the positioning end, limiting plate, and riveted flange, the problem of slippage and loosening of the mold clamping nail in the luggage caster is solved, achieving higher connection strength and stability.

AI Technical Summary
Existing mold-fitting nails are prone to slipping and falling off under stress in the luggage casters, resulting in unstable connections.
It adopts a combination structure of positioning end, limiting plate and riveted flange. The positioning end is built into the mounting groove of the wheel frame and abuts against the inner wall of the mounting groove through the multi-sided side wall. Combined with the hard contact between the limiting plate and the edge of the mounting groove, the riveted flange decomposes the vertical force, and the arc transition surface cooperates in bearing the force, which enhances mechanical interlocking and impact resistance.
It effectively reduces the slippage and loosening of the mold clamping pins, improves load capacity and durability, and enhances the connection strength and stability of the luggage casters.

Technical Field
[0001] This application relates to the field of hardware products, and in particular to a mold-fitting nail and a bag caster using the mold-fitting nail. Background Technology
[0002] Mold fittings, as a traditional hardware component, are typically used for the casters of luggage and similar bags.
[0003] In related technologies, the mold-fitting nail includes a nearly circular mounting end and a nail body. It mainly achieves a stable connection between the wheel body and the housing by rigidly connecting the mounting end inside the mounting groove of the wheel frame.
[0004] The existing mold-fitting nails have the following problems: after installation, the nearly round head of the mold-fitting nail is prone to rotating in the wheel frame of luggage or similar bags and can easily fall off under stress. Summary of the Invention
[0005] In order to reduce the occurrence of slippage and loosening of the mold clamping pin in the connected workpieces, this application provides a mold clamping pin and a bag caster using the mold clamping pin.
[0006] The technical solution provided in this application for a mold-fitting nail and a bag caster using the mold-fitting nail is as follows:
[0007] A mold clamping pin includes: a positioning end, a limiting plate, a vertical shaft, and a riveting flange. The positioning end, the limiting plate, the vertical shaft, and the riveting flange are sequentially fixedly connected. The positioning end has a polygonal structure. After the mold clamping pin is locked, the positioning end is built into the mounting groove of the wheel frame, and each side wall of the positioning end abuts against the inner wall of the mounting groove.
[0008] By adopting the above solution, after the mold clamping nail is locked, the positioning end is built into the mounting groove of the wheel frame. The multi-sided sidewalls of the positioning end abut against the inner wall of the mounting groove. By increasing the contact area between the positioning end and the mounting groove, the occurrence of mold clamping nail rotating under force or even sliding and loosening is reduced.
[0009] Preferably, the positioning end is located at the top of the vertical shaft, and the upper surface of the positioning end is provided with a cross groove, the walls of which are all rounded.
[0010] By adopting the above scheme, the positioning end forms a mechanical interlocking structure, which increases the matching degree between the positioning end and the inner wall of the mounting groove, further enhancing the anti-slip performance of the positioning end. The cross groove can also play a role in dispersing stress during the installation process.
[0011] Preferably, the limiting disk is disposed in the area of the vertical axis in the middle, close to the positioning end, and the limiting disk is in the shape of a perfect circle, the diameter of the limiting disk being larger than the diameter of the positioning end.
[0012] By adopting the above solution, the limiting plate limits the pressing depth of the mold clamping pin by making hard contact with the edge of the mounting groove of the wheel frame, thereby reducing the occurrence of excessive embedding of the mold clamping pin and resulting in a decrease in connection strength.
[0013] Preferably, the riveting flange is located at the bottom of the vertical shaft, and the riveting flange is shaped like a frustum.
[0014] By adopting the above scheme, the pressure in the vertical direction is decomposed, and most of the force is applied to the riveting flange, while a small amount of force produces axial deformation, thus reducing the occurrence of excessive stress and deformation of the mold clamping nail.
[0015] Preferably, the connection points of the positioning end, the limiting plate, the riveting flange, and the vertical shaft are all provided with arc-shaped transition surfaces.
[0016] By adopting the above scheme, the arc-shaped transition surface transmits the lateral impact force to the vertical axis along the tangential direction, reducing the sudden change in stress at the connection point, which could lead to the mold clamping nail breaking and falling off the wheel frame. The multiple arc surfaces work together to bear the force, improving the overall stiffness and elastic recovery ability of the mold clamping nail.
[0017] Preferably, a bag caster includes the aforementioned mold-fitting nail, characterized in that it further includes a first wheel frame, a second wheel frame, and a roller, wherein the first wheel frame is provided with a mounting groove, the positioning end is built into the mounting groove, one end of the vertical shaft is fixedly connected to the mounting groove, the second wheel frame is provided with a connecting hole, and the other end of the vertical shaft is interference-fitted with the connecting hole.
[0018] By adopting the above solution, the first wheel frame and the second wheel frame are tightly connected by mold-fitting nails, which improves the mechanical strength and structural stability of the luggage casters.
[0019] Preferably, the opening edge of the connecting hole is provided with a guide surface.
[0020] By adopting the above scheme, the guide surface and the other end of the vertical axis form a progressive contact. In the initial stage of installation and fitting, the coaxiality deviation is automatically corrected by the curved surface sliding, so that the mold closing nail can achieve axial positioning.
[0021] Preferably, 2 / 5 of the vertical shaft is connected to the first wheel frame, and 3 / 5 of the vertical shaft is connected to the second wheel frame.
[0022] By adopting the above solution and adjusting the length required for different mating methods at each end of the mold clamping nail, the impact resistance and durability of the mold clamping nail can be balanced simultaneously.
[0023] In summary, this application includes at least one of the following beneficial technical effects:
[0024] 1. It reduces the occurrence of mold clamping pins rotating under stress or even sliding and loosening in the connected workpieces;
[0025] 2. Improved the load-bearing capacity and durability of the mold clamping nails;
[0026] 3. Improved the connection strength and stability of luggage casters. Attached Figure Description

[0033] The following is in conjunction with the appendix Figure 1-5 This application will be described in further detail.
[0034] In this embodiment, the mold-fitting nail is normally used on the casters of luggage such as suitcases. The top of the mold-fitting nail is connected and fixed to the first wheel frame 7 of the suitcase, and the bottom of the mold-fitting nail is fixedly connected to the second wheel frame 8 of the suitcase.
[0035] Example 1
[0036] This application discloses a mold-closing nail. (Refer to...) Figure 1A mold clamping nail includes a positioning end 1, a limiting plate 2, a vertical shaft 3, and a riveting flange 5. The positioning end 1 is integrally formed at one end of the vertical shaft 3, and the riveting flange 5 is integrally formed at the other end of the vertical shaft 3. The limiting plate 2 is integrally formed on the vertical outer wall and is located between the positioning end 1 and the riveting flange 5. In this embodiment, the positioning end 1 is arranged in the form of a regular hexahedron. After the mold clamping nail is locked, the positioning end 1 is built into the mounting groove 71 of the wheel frame of a suitcase or similar bag. Compared with the near-circular mounting end of the traditional mold clamping nail, because the circle has no fixed force point, the contact surface of the workpiece is prone to tangential sliding. However, the six side walls of the positioning end 1 all abut against the inner wall of the mounting groove 71. Each side acts as an independent force unit, forming multi-directional support when the mold clamping nail vibrates, making the stress distribution more uniform and reducing the occurrence of the mold clamping nail rotating under force or even sliding and loosening.
[0037] Furthermore, a cross groove 11 is provided on the upper surface of the positioning end 1, and the groove walls of the cross groove 11 are all rounded. Therefore, the positioning end 1 and the inner wall of the mounting groove 71 form a multi-faceted interlock, which increases the geometric matching degree between the positioning end 1 and the mounting groove 71, and indirectly enhances the anti-slip performance and stress resistance of the mold clamping nail.
[0038] In addition, the outer side wall of the limiting plate 2 abuts against the inner side wall of the mounting groove 71, forming a mechanical interlock structure with the positioning end 1. By limiting the pressing depth of the mold clamping pin, the situation where the mold clamping pin is over-embedded and the connection strength decreases is reduced.
[0039] Furthermore, the limiting plate 2 is in the shape of a perfect circle, and the diameter of the limiting plate 2 is larger than the diameter of the positioning end 1. The part of the edge of the limiting plate 2 that extends beyond the installation end forms a buffer zone, which converts the axial tensile force into radial shear force, reducing the occurrence of stress concentration that could lead to cracks in the mold clamping pin. The limiting plate 2 also slows down the gradual loosening of the mold clamping pin during vibration by increasing the friction contact area.
[0040] In addition, the riveted flange 5 is set in a frustum shape, which provides expansion space for the mold closing nail. This can reduce the mechanical damage to the mold closing nail caused by thermal expansion and contraction, and also reduce the strength of the fit with the wheel frame, indirectly improving the flexible rotation of the roller 6.
[0041] Furthermore, the riveting flange 5 can decompose the pressure in the vertical direction into radial expansion force and axial constraint force, and apply most of the force to the riveting flange 5, while using a small amount of force to generate axial deformation, thereby reducing the occurrence of excessive stress on the mold clamping pin.
[0042] Furthermore, the riveting flange 5, in conjunction with the limiting plate 2, achieves axial restriction of the mold closing nail. Moreover, if a reasonable tolerance range is uniformly applied to the riveting flange 5, the height consistency of multiple sets of luggage casters after installation can be improved.
[0043] Meanwhile, the connection points of the positioning end 1, the limiting plate 2, the riveting flange 5, and the vertical shaft 3 are all provided with arc-shaped transition surfaces 4. The arc-shaped transition surfaces 4 form a continuous gradient channel in the integrally formed mold cavity, reducing the dead zone of material flow. The arc-shaped transition surfaces 4 also change the contact between the mold closing pin and the mold cavity from sliding friction to rolling friction, making the demolding process more convenient.
[0044] Furthermore, the arc-shaped transition surface 4 can guide the lateral impact force to be transmitted along the tangent direction of the vertical axis 3, reducing stress accumulation at the connection point and preventing the mold clamping nail from suddenly breaking and falling off the wheel frame. At the same time, the multiple arc surfaces work together to bear the force, which improves the structural strength of the mold clamping nail and extends its service life.
[0045] Example 2
[0046] On the other hand, this application discloses a bag caster, referring to... Figure 2-5 The system includes a mold-fitting nail as described in Embodiment 1, as well as a first wheel frame 7, a second wheel frame 8, and a roller 6. The first wheel frame 7 has an installation groove 71. In this embodiment, the end of the vertical shaft 3 with the positioning end 1 is fixedly installed in the installation groove 71 by injection molding. The second wheel frame 8 is provided with a connecting hole 81. The end of the vertical shaft 3 with the riveted flange 5 is riveted to the connecting hole 81 to achieve an interference fit. In addition, a transverse fastener 82 is added to the bottom of the connecting hole 81. The transverse fastener 82 limits the riveted flange 5 by passing through the bottom of the connecting hole 81. The mold-fitting nail thus tightly connects the first wheel frame 7 and the second wheel frame 8, improving the mechanical strength and structural stability of the luggage caster.
[0047] Specifically, 2 / 5 of the vertical shaft 3 is fixed in the mounting groove 71 by injection molding, and 3 / 5 of the vertical shaft 3 is riveted to the connecting hole 81 to achieve an interference fit, which at the same time improves the impact resistance and durability of the mold clamping pin.
[0048] Furthermore, the opening edge of the connecting hole 81 is provided with a guide surface 811, which plays an axial guiding role during the installation of the mold clamping nail and the connecting hole 81. When the roller 6 turns, the lateral force generated is converted into the torque of the vertical shaft 3 through the arc-shaped guide surface 811. The arc-shaped sliding compensates for the elastic deformation and maintains the stability of the connection structure.
[0049] The implementation principle of a mold-locking nail in this embodiment is as follows: the head and tail ends of the mold-locking nail are fixedly connected to the two wheel frames of the luggage caster, respectively. After the mold-locking nail is locked, the hexagonal positioning end 1 of the mold-locking nail in this embodiment has a larger contact area than the nearly circular installation end of the traditional mold-locking nail. By increasing the contact area between the mold-locking nail and the wheel frame mounting groove 71, the occurrence of mold-locking nail rotation under force or even slippage and loosening is effectively reduced.
